Senior Research Associate


Uniconpharma inc.


Location

Petaluma, CA | United States


Job description

Organize and maintain mouse colonies - schedule should be flexible based on animal care needs (occasional weekend and holiday work will be required/split across team members)

Assist in the design of in vivo model systems/proof of concept studies that promote the translatability between animal models and human disease.

Perform in vivo lab experiments including but not limited to dosing (ip, iv, sc, po), PK/PD studies, husbandry, sample/tissue collections.

Recognize and adhere to IACUC standards of in vivo research.

Review and contribute to study synopses, protocols, study reports and regulatory documents.

Perform data recording and statistical analysis; Document all experimental procedures and data in electronic notebook.

Engage with project teams in a collaborative manner, and over time present results, analyses, conclusions, and implications to the team.

Share responsibility over lab maintenance duties.

Requirements:

SRA2: bachelor's degree with at least 8 years of relevant experience or master's degree with at least 6 years of relevant experience, musculoskeletal research background is highly desired.

Demonstrated ability in rodent handling (mouse, rat) and experience with PK/PD studies and different routes of administration: IP, IV, SC, PO

In vivo surgical experience is strongly preferred, experience with in vivo imaging is a plus.

Experience in managing contract research organizations is desirable.

Ability to work independently as well as collaboratively in a dynamic environment.

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, desire to learn new techniques.

Excellent oral and written English communication skills.
Employment Type: Full-Time
Salary: $ 140,000.00 Per Year
